Core Java with Android

Are you passionate about building Android applications but lack the core programming knowledge to kickstart your journey? Look no further than Aarvy Edutech‘s core Java with Android training in Gurgaon! This comprehensive program equips you with a solid understanding of Java, the essential building block for Android development.

Why Master Core Java Before Android Development?

Java serves as the foundation for Android app development. By mastering core Java concepts, you gain the necessary programming skills to effectively navigate the Android development landscape. Here’s why Java is crucial:

    • Strong Programming Fundamentals: Core Java provides a strong foundation in object-oriented programming (OOP) principles, essential for structuring efficient and maintainable Android applications.
    • Understanding Core Java Libraries: Android development heavily relies on core Java libraries like collections, I/O operations, and networking. A solid grasp of these libraries is vital.
    • Problem-Solving Skills: Core Java training hones your problem-solving and analytical skills, preparing you to tackle complex challenges encountered during Android development.
    • Seamless Transition to Android: With a strong Core Java foundation, you’ll transition smoothly to learning the intricacies of the Android framework, accelerating your app development journey.


Key Highlights of Our Course

    • Focus on Java Fundamentals: Our curriculum prioritizes a thorough understanding of Java concepts, ensuring a strong foundation for Android development.
    • Expert-Led Training: Learn from experienced Java developers passionate about teaching and sharing their industry knowledge.
    • Interactive Learning Environment: Ask questions, receive personalized feedback, and connect with fellow coding enthusiasts in our collaborative classrooms.
    • Hands-on Learning Approach: Solidify your understanding through practical coding exercises, real-world application examples, and mini-projects.

    • Bridge to Android Development: This course lays the groundwork for your Android development journey, making the transition smooth and efficient.
    • Flexible Learning Options: Choose from in-person classes at our Gurgaon location or convenient online sessions that you can attend from anywhere.


Skills You Will Gain

In this course, you will learn: 

    • Core Java Fundamentals: Master the core concepts of Java programming, including object-oriented programming (OOP), variables, data types, operators, control flow statements, and inheritance.
    • Working with Classes and Objects: Understand how to create classes and objects, and leverage inheritance for code reusability.
    • Collections Framework: Explore and utilize Java’s powerful collections framework for efficient data organization and manipulation.
    • Exception Handling: Learn robust exception-handling techniques to manage errors and ensure application stability.
    • Input/Output (I/O) Operations: Understand how to perform file I/O operations for data persistence within your applications.
    • Networking Fundamentals: Gain foundational knowledge of network programming concepts relevant to Android application development.
    • Problem-Solving and Algorithmic Thinking: Develop strong problem-solving skills and enhance your algorithmic thinking to tackle programming challenges effectively.
    • Preparation for Android Development: Prepare for a seamless transition to learning the Android framework with a strong core Java and Android foundation.